MorGothic wrote...
Yes, the Loghain and Zevran meeting cutscene will play when you complete one of the main quests, and then travel. It will then either play when you reach your destination or if you hit another encounter (instead of playing the Ambush it will give you a different one, leaving the game paradox free).

ejoslin wrote...
Sabriana wrote...
He ambushes twice? How is that possible? Or am I not getting something right here?
No, you go back to the ambush area though. In the initial encounter, the tree gets knocked over, blocking you in. When you go back, the tree is there, blocking you out. I'm hoping someone who's smarter than I am will say how to get out of there! My guess is there's a console command that will teleport you.
I'd try
runscript zz_jump_around
to make sure you are at the right exit of the map
If you still can't get out, you could try
runscript zz_camp_debug
or some tentative poking around at other debug commands like zz_dlc_debug or zz_shl_debug, and see if they give you the option to teleport someplace, for example Honnleath
